IDE Card
 
 
Feature
High reliability
  Due to the fact that it is only composed of semiconductor parts, it is superior in regards to oscillation   resistance.
Maintenance free
 
High-speed access
  random access (Sustained)
Read:8MB/sec
Write:6MB/sec
 
low power consumption
  when in motion: 0.75W
when stopped: 0.02W
 
caution: Although it has the same dimensions as the PC-ATA card, it does not support notebook PC (PCMCIA interface) cards.
